How long do the Refugees get to stay

In the refugee Camp?

I think that the refugees get to stay in the camp for no longer than 2 weeks.

The refugees stay in the camp for 6 weeks and they go to school from 9 am until 2:30pm. During this time the camp sets up a bank account, organizes a house to stay in and find a local school for the refugees.

Do you have Stationary and other tools to help them with their English education

Only a few things, but not too many.

The refugees get to go to an AUT campus located in the camp. The campus have classes to help them with their English. They MUST attend unless sick in which they go to a doctors room. They go at normal school hours to get used to the school routine when they leave the camp.
